What is FaithWords Joyce Meyer "The Power of Thank You"?

FaithWords Joyce Meyer's "The Power of Thank You" is a book about the importance of gratitude in our daily lives. In this book, Meyer explores how expressing gratitude can transform our attitude and perspective, leading to a more fulfilling and positive life.

Meyer begins by explaining the significance of thankfulness in the Bible, drawing on several passages to emphasize the importance of gratitude in our spiritual walk. She then delves into the practical ways we can cultivate an attitude of thanksgiving, including the benefits that come with it.

In "The Power of Thank You," Meyer doesn't shy away from discussing the difficulties and challenges we face in life. However, she encourages readers to look beyond their circumstances and focus on the many blessings God has provided. By acknowledging and appreciating these blessings, we can experience a significant shift in our mindset and outlook.

Throughout the book, Meyer shares personal anecdotes and stories of individuals who have experienced the transformative power of thankfulness. Her writing is warm and accessible, making it easy for readers to connect with her message and apply it to their own lives.

Overall, "The Power of Thank You" is a powerful reminder that gratitude is not just a nice sentiment, but rather a vital component of a meaningful and joyful life.

Being thankful helps you bond. Research by U.S. psychologists Sara Algoe and Baldwin Way indicates that gratitude also can lead to better relationships. The explanation may be connected to increased production of oxytocin, sometimes called the “bonding hormone” because it fosters calm and security in relationships.
